What was meant to be a celebration to welcome 2026 turned into tragedy after a fire broke out at a bar-nightclub in the Swiss ski resort of Crans-Montana. The incident left several people dead and injured, including Tahirys dos Santos, a 19-year-old player from FC Metz’s youth system.
What happened to Tahirys dos Santos?
The young footballer was airlifted to Stuttgart, Germany, after suffering severe burns across his body.
“Saying that he is doing well would be misleading because he is suffering terribly. He has burns on 30% of his body. The positive sign is that his respiratory capacity has improved significantly,”
explained his agent, Christophe Hutteau, in an interview with BFMTV.

Metz reacts to the tragedy involving their young player
FC Metz released an official statement expressing its deep concern and support for the young prospect, describing these moments as hours in which he is “fighting through immense suffering”.
First-team player Gauthier Hein also spoke publicly about the situation:
“I want to say that the entire team is very concerned about what is happening. We all support Tahirys and his family. We are thinking of them and waiting for updates on his condition and progress. Our thoughts are with him and his loved ones”.
